Short CD History In 1990, Capitol decided to release all their Beach Boys' albums on CD, putting two complete albums onto one CD (their albums run to approx. 25 minutes!) and including some single, B-sides and previously unreleased tracks on the end to entice the collectors. The material was digitally remastered and the whole project was handled with care. Unfortunately, recently Capitol in their infinite wisdom, deleted these 'two-fers' and re-released the albums, one to each CD without the bonus songs. The 1990 releases of Christmas Album and Pet Sounds are still available. The Brother/Caribou CDs were also digitally remastered, although for some of the songs the wrong masters were used. These reissues have also been deleted. Beach Boys fans have it real tough, don't they? However, the entire 1962-1985 album catalogue was recently re-issued on CD again, so it's not all bad news. Hollywood Bowl, Hollywood, CA November 1, 1963 The Beach Boys were the last act of the day for "Y-Day", sponsored by the Hollywood YMCA and local station KFWB. They were only supposed to perform three songs, but decided on-the-spot to perform "Surfer Girl" as well. They also sang a short acapella tribute to KFWB.

Georgetown University, Washington, DC November 7, 1971 C-Man writes: "This is THE SHOW that turned David Leaf from a casual hits-oriented fan into the fan-atic that would one day write the best book ever on the group, "The Beach Boys And The California Myth" (not to mention the fact that he is now Brian Wilson's personal manager). In the special 50th issue of STOMP! (August 1985) David lists his ten (actually he cheated and listed 11) favorite Beach Boys concerts. Not surprisingly, this took first place. Here is what he said regarding this show: "1. Fall, 1971, Georgetown University: Don't even have to think about this. The band was at its performing peak, the material was a near-perfect blend of old and new, Dennis played ballads at the piano and Carl sang "Surf's Up", "Help Me Rhonda" was a revelation. On top of everything else, I had a free, second row seat" (because he was reviewing the show for his college newspaper)." .

Editor note: It's notable that Dennis performs "Barbara" and "I've Got A Friend", two songs that were unreleased at the time.

Long Beach Arena, Long Beach, CA December 3, 1971 C-Man writes: "Probably the only performance ever of 'A Day In The Life Of A Tree'. The Boys coaxed Brian out from the side of the stage to play organ while Jack Rieley sang it. They were going to do 'Heroes and Villains', but had to shorten the set because the Long Beach Police were going to turn the power off at a certain time. At the end of the main set, following 'Surf's Up', Jack Rieley comes onstage and announces they have just enough time to do two more before the plug is pulled, so instead of leaving and coming back for an encore, they just stay on stage and do the last two. The high vocal part on the end of 'Fun Fun Fun' is performed exactly 25 times tonight (I counted 'em!). Brian may have joined in for that, but Rob isn't sure. Contrary to what is written in Keith Badman's book, 'Surfer Girl' is not performed tonight."

Lakeland Civic Center, Lakeland, FL September 3, 1978 C-Man writes: "An extra long show, especially considering the group had played another concert, in Miami, earlier that day. This was one of Bruce's first shows since returning to the band. Although at the time Bruce's return was being called "temporary", we all know how that went...Bruce had joined the guys in Miami, at Brian's request, to work on tracks for the 'L.A. (Light Album)' in-between dates of this southeast tour. Also accompanying the group were Jan & Dean, who performed a total of four songs with the Boys. Brian was in good voice and played bass most of the show. Dennis, unfortunately, was very drunk and abandoned his drum kit in favor of the frontstage mics for 'In My Room' (Carl commanded him back to the drums for the next song), and the last several songs (starting with 'Rock And Roll Music' and apparently continuing through the encore). Bobby Figueroa switched from percussion to drums to cover for Dennis. Members of the audience could be heard shouting things like 'Sober up!', 'You're plastered!', and 'I can smell the whiskey!'. At the beginning of the encore, Carli Munoz started playing the piano intro to 'You Are So Beautiful', but instead of singing that song right away, Dennis introduced Bruce, who came out and did 'I Write The Songs' (according to him, for the first time in front of an audience). Following that number, Carli and Dennis returned to do 'You Are So Beautiful', with Dennis jokingly thanking 'Texas' and 'Kansas' instead of Florida."
